mirror of
https://github.com/davidhalter/typeshed.git
synced 2025-12-07 12:44:28 +08:00
Use PEP 570 syntax in stdlib (#11250)
This commit is contained in:
@@ -180,7 +180,7 @@ class Values:
|
||||
def read_file(self, filename: str, mode: str = "careful") -> None: ...
|
||||
def read_module(self, modname: str, mode: str = "careful") -> None: ...
|
||||
def __getattr__(self, name: str) -> Any: ...
|
||||
def __setattr__(self, __name: str, __value: Any) -> None: ...
|
||||
def __setattr__(self, name: str, value: Any, /) -> None: ...
|
||||
def __eq__(self, other: object) -> bool: ...
|
||||
|
||||
class OptionParser(OptionContainer):
|
||||
@@ -222,7 +222,7 @@ class OptionParser(OptionContainer):
|
||||
def _process_long_opt(self, rargs: list[Any], values: Any) -> None: ...
|
||||
def _process_short_opts(self, rargs: list[Any], values: Any) -> None: ...
|
||||
@overload
|
||||
def add_option_group(self, __opt_group: OptionGroup) -> OptionGroup: ...
|
||||
def add_option_group(self, opt_group: OptionGroup, /) -> OptionGroup: ...
|
||||
@overload
|
||||
def add_option_group(self, *args: Any, **kwargs: Any) -> OptionGroup: ...
|
||||
def check_values(self, values: Values, args: list[str]) -> tuple[Values, list[str]]: ...
|
||||
|
||||
Reference in New Issue
Block a user